Автор Тема: Обновление пакетов: gst-plugins-base ошибка  (Прочитано 4772 раз)

Оффлайн xterro

  • Давно тут
  • **
  • Сообщений: 207
    • Email
Доброго времени суток,  в последнее время заметил такое сообщение при обновлении пакетов на машине

Preparing...                 ############################################################################################# [100%]
file /usr/lib64/gstreamer-1.0/libgstrawparse.so from install of gst-plugins-base1.0-1.12.3-alt0.M80P.1 conflicts with file from package gst-plugins-bad1.0-1.10.5-alt0.M80P.1
E: Ошибка во время исполнения транзакции

Такое и на "рабочей станции" и на "симпли"  8-версии. Хотя раньше пакеты обновлялись без проблем,
что случилось?

Подключены репы:

[altlinux@localhost apt]$ cat sources.list
rpm [p8] ftp://ftp.altlinux.org/pub/distributions/ALTLinux p8/branch/x86_64 classic
rpm [p8] ftp://ftp.altlinux.org/pub/distributions/ALTLinux p8/branch/x86_64-i586 classic
rpm [p8] ftp://ftp.altlinux.org/pub/distributions/ALTLinux p8/branch/noarch classic

« Последнее редактирование: 16.10.2017 19:38:12 от xterro »

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 099
Типичная ошибка в spec-файле при сборке - недопроставленный "Conflicts". Повесте баг в багзилле на gst-plugins соответствующий. Так бывает иногда.

Собственно, вот про похожую проблему: https://forum.altlinux.org/index.php?topic=40184.0. Можете так же проверить возможность установки пакета с одновременным удалением, но внимательно смотрите на то, что будет написано в "Следующие пакеты будут УДАЛЕНЫ", а то там человек чуть систему не вынес - спасла следующая ошибка.
« Последнее редактирование: 16.10.2017 20:17:00 от asy »

Оффлайн xterro

  • Давно тут
  • **
  • Сообщений: 207
    • Email
Спасибо, повешал багу #34020  :-)

Оффлайн mnk

  • Начинающий
  • *
  • Сообщений: 1
    • Email
Странно, но до сих пор не починили.
Установил новую систему, потом
apt-get upgrade
И не может, вываливается с ошибкой
Цитировать
file /usr/lib64/gstreamer-1.0/libgstrawparse.so from install of gst-plugins-base1.0-1.12.3-alt0.M80P.1 conflicts with file from package gst-plugins-bad1.0-1.10.5-alt0.M80P.1
И как обновить теперь систему.

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 099
apt-get install gst-plugins-base1.0 gst-plugins-bad1.0-

"-" в конце названия пакета означает необходимость удаления в этой же транзакции.

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 908
    • Домашняя страница
    • Email
Те, кто под Альтом делают apt-get upgrade, сами виноваты в ошибках.
Надо apt-get dist-upgrade. Читайте документацию.
Андрей Черепанов (cas@)

Оффлайн asy

  • alt linux team
  • ***
  • Сообщений: 8 099
Те, кто под Альтом делают apt-get upgrade, сами виноваты в ошибках.
Надо apt-get dist-upgrade. Читайте документацию.
Вообще, про upgrade/dist-upgrade не написано. Но действительно, а что именно использовано для обновления?

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 19 908
    • Домашняя страница
    • Email
http://altlinux.org/Install
И руководства по дистрибутивам.
Андрей Черепанов (cas@)